Opportunity at a Glance: Latinx students can experience a wide range of emotions—ranging from deep cultural pride to feelings of alienation—when thinking about themselves in relation to their languages.  Join The New York Public Library’s Center for Educators and Schools (CES) for a conversation about language, identity, self-perception, and cultural belonging.

Dr. Lori Gallegos will discuss the complex relationship between language and Latinidad, how language speakers navigate feelings of shame and pride about their linguistic heritage, and the role educators play in supporting multilingual students.
